Registration for expo underway

By Neo Kolane

The Basotho Enterprise Development Corporation (BEDCO) and its partners are calling on all micro, small and medium enterprises to register for the 2021 virtual entrepreneurship expo

Registration started on September 1 and will end on September 29.

The purpose of the corporation is to establish and develop Basotho-owned business enterprises with particular emphasis on the promotion of indigenous entrepreneurial skills.

Speaking with theReporter, BEDCO’s project manager for market access, Tṧepiso Mofolo said for this year’s expo, the corporation is hoping for 200 micro, small and medium enterprises to showcase their products. At least 5 000 people re expected to attend, while BEDC will give training to 15 000 people during the five days of the expo.

“The date for the expo has not been set but we are hoping to host it towards the end of November,” Mofolo said.
